I'm sure many of us have done that. We do amazing works for others and we like to tell people about it. Have you ever done that?

Have you ever made someone feel better and told people about how you did it?
Have you ever gone out on the streets, got some food for the hungry and let people see how christian you are?

Well, to tell you the truth, the praise and that warm fuzzy feeling you get for doing that in front of people just means that you've got your reward in full already. Why is this? Sounds a little unchristian hey? Hehe :holy:

Good works is motivated by faith. 'Faith without works' is dead as you've all heard.

When you do your good works in secret, God see's that in secret and He rewards it. But if you show it to people of your good works, then you get no reward from God.

I mean, sure, people say 'hey, he's a cool christian because he did that.' Voila! That's your reward, 1 sentence and a few seconds worth of 'fuzzyness'. That's a great reward hey? :rolleyes:

No no. We are rewarded for good deeds in secret. If you give to charity, be annanomous. If you tithe, (not sure if that's classified as a good work) give without anyone knowing the amount. When you make someone feel better, do it when people aren't watching. If you're praying, go to the most private place to pray (huza for those who don't like praying with people :)).

Because doing this, God will honor that good work that you ahve done without getting praise from people but from God.

Matthew 6:1
"Take care not to do your good deeds publicaly or before men, in order to be seen by them; otherwise you will have no reward [reserved for and awaiting you] with and from your Father Who is in heaven."

We have a homeless ministry - we go out on the streets two nights a week, taking food, soup, coffee, clothes, blankets, toiletries, bibles, etc.

We tell EVERYONE about it!

We don't do it to brag, but to expose the desperate need..... to inform people how they can help. If we didn't do that, the ministry would not grow and we wouldn't have all the volunteers and supplies we need (as the need is great).

Many times after I speak, people say things like: "Wow! You guys are awesome to do what you do!"..... we just let it roll off, knowing that our real blessing is in doing what Jesus would've done... to the least of these.

So, I believe there are times when doing good works SHOULD be talked about!

Thanks for this thread, Sharky. Talk about one of my major areas of weakness! :( The warm fuzzies can jump right into to pride in a heartbeat.

But I do agree with Xundignified to an extent. Serving him well, feeling joy about it and sharing it with loved ones isn't what I think Matthew is refering to. Nor do I think it's wrong to recount deeds to inspire others. What would Christian literature be without Corrie ten Boom's autobiography, The Hiding Place. In it she tells of the sacrifices she and her family made in WWII hiding Jews in Holland. She lived heroically, but the way the book is written gives all honor and glory to God.
